문제점네이티브 쿼리를 사용하여 DB에 의존적image해결책쿼리DSL을 사용image
like 조회(쿼리수 7번)좋아요한 회원이 많을수록 for문이 돌아 쿼리가 점점 늘어남like 조회(쿼리수 3번)
인프런 강의 : https://www.inflearn.com/course/the-java-application-test 책 : 테스트 주도 개발 시작하기 참고 자료 : https://twer.tistory.com/entry/JUnit5-RunWith https://t
정리해보고 있는데 그냥 https://rebro.kr/167 이 글을 읽는게 훨씬 나아보인다. (정리가 무진장 잘 되어있다.) 인덱스(Index)는 데이터베이스의 테이블에 대한 검색 속도를 향상시켜주는 자료구조이다. 테이블의 특정 컬럼(Column)에 인덱스를 생성하
@ExceptionHandler - 이해 xController계층에서 발생하는 에러를 잡아서 메서드로 처리해주는 기능(Service, Repository는 제외)value 값으로 어떤 Exception을 처리 할 것인지 넘겨줄 수 있는데, value를 설정하지 않으면
@NoArgsConstructor @RequiredArgsConstructor @AllArgsConstructor
@JoinColumn @ManyToOne을 할 때 어떤 Entity를 연결하는지 알려주는 어노테이션 @JoinColumn옆에 name에 연결하는 Entity에서 어떤 값으로 비교하여 받아오고 싶은지에 대한 값 private Member member; 연결하는 Enti
N+1 문제란? 연관 관계에서 발생하는 이슈로 연관 관계가 설정된 엔티티를 조회할 경우에 조회된 데이터 갯수(n) 만큼 연관관계의 조회 쿼리가 추가로 발생하여 데이터를 읽어오게 된다. 이를 N+1 문제라고 한다. 조회 시 1개의 쿼리를 생각하고 설계를 했으나 나오지